Abstract

CoolThink@JC, which launched in 2016, is scaling the study of computational thinking to primary 4-6 students across the territory. This report examines the progress made by the CoolThink@JC initiative at midline and describes CoolThink implementation at the classroom and school levels after one and two years of CoolThink adoption, the development of an emerging ecosystem that can support CoolThink@JC at scale in Hong Kong, and the important factors to successful adoption by the full breadth of primary schools in the territory.
